Abiudh

A funny guy who likes to get on your nerves when he can. This kind of person is a deity when it comes to IQ and is probably the nicest person you’ll ever meet
Person1: “Woah that dude is super nice.”
Person2: “Yeah, must be an Abiudh”
by Anatis July 18, 2023
mugGet the Abiudh mug.